Archive Guide to German Colonial History with new Offers
Since 2019, the web portal "Archive Guide to German Colonial History" has provided access to metadata on colonial history holdings from over 450 archives. It has been updated with new indexing data, a thesaurus, maps and the Kurrent typewriter to promote research into colonial history.
